The Ethnological Museum in Addis Ababa was established in 1950, largely based on the collections of old Italian zoological species and ethnographic artifacts by the first batch of graduates of the College. The initiator of the idea of the museum came from Stanislaw Chojnaki who was the former chief librarian of the University College of Addis.

The Ethiopia Museum of Art and Science Science [2] is a 15,000 m 2 (160,000 sq ft) lying science museum in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ia. It was inaugurated by Prime Minister Abiy Ahmed along with other high-ranking officials on 4 October 2022. Part of Chinese aided Addis Ababa Riverside Development Project Phase II, the museum contains exhibition hall.

Currently it serves as Addis Ababa Museum. This was established in October 1986 on the occasion of the centennial anniversary of the foundation of Addis Ababa as a capital city. It is housed in one of the oldest buildings which were once the house of one of emperor Menelik II's war lord, Ras Biru Wolde Gebriel. It has 7 halls. 1. Finfine hall. 2.

Julie Mehretu (Ethiopian/American, b.1970) is an Abstract printmaker and painter. She was born in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ia, and moved to Michigan with her family in 1977. She began her education at the University Cheikh Anta Diop in Dakar, and then went on to earn a BA in Art from Kalamazoo College, and a MFA from the Rhode Island School of Art and Design in 1997.

The museum keeps candid portraits of the redoubtable Empress Taitu, rakish Lij Iyasu, and the very beautiful Empress Zewditu, along with pictures of the capital in its infancy. There's also a 'first-in-Ethiopia' room, with pictures of Menelik with Bede Bentley in Addis Ababa's first motor car (1907) and the first telephone in Ethiopia.

The National Museum of Ethiopia, situated in the heart of the capital, Addis Ababa, near the Addis Ababa University's graduate school, is a repository of the country's cultural, historical, and archaeological treasures. It is also recognized for housing significant paleoanthropological exhibits.

The National Museum of Ethiopia (NME), also referred to as the Ethiopian National Museum, is a national museum in Ethiopia. It is located in the capital, Addis Ababa, near the Addis Ababa University's graduate school. Overview. The museum houses Ethiopia's artistic treasures.

Despite only being founded on Addis' centenary in 1986, the Addis Ababa Museum is the city's scruffiest museum. That said, perusing candid portraits of the redoubtable Empress Taitu, rakish Lij Iyasu and the very beautiful Empress Zewditu, along with pictures of the capital in its infancy, is still worth an hour or so.
